What We’re Reading 

Ila is reading The Family Experiment, by John Marrs. 

Set in a world where most of society are living paycheque to paycheque and can barely afford to cover their own bills, very few are able to afford to start a family. The Family Experiment is a new reality tv show, with 12 contestants given the opportunity to raise one of the newly launched MetaChildren, their very own virtual AI child. Over the span of 9 months, their child will grow from a newborn to an 18 year old, with every second of their and their parent’s lives broadcast live for the world to watch, judge and vote. By the end of the 9 months one lucky couple will win, choosing to either keep their MetaChild or win the money needed to start a real family of their own. For those not so lucky to win, their child will be permanently terminated. 

The Family Experiment by John Marrs is a near-future dystopian science fiction/horror book set in the UK exploring the ideas of late stage capitalism and the impact of AI. It is told from the point of views of the different contestants; they are all different ages, races, gender, sexualities, and class, but the one thing they have in common is that they all have something to hide.


Kate is reading Good Spirits by B.K. Borison.

Harriet York, lifelong people-pleaser, is an antique shop owner whose worst sin is standing up for herself. So what has she done to deserve a haunting by Nolan, one of many Ghosts of Christmas Past? Then again, maybe Nolan’s not there to save Harriet - maybe this haunting is about him. A funny, heartfelt and challenging Christmas Carol retelling, which is short enough to read before Christmas.
